我刚刚开始使用php api和php进行开发.但是当我调用以下查询时,我似乎无法弄清楚为什么我只得到一个空数组:
$fql = "SELECT message,time FROM status WHERE uid ='".$uid."'";
$response = $facebook->api(array('method' => 'fql.query','query' =>$fql));
print_r($response);
Run Code Online (Sandbox Code Playgroud)
当我使用不同的查询,如下所示我得到结果:
$fql = "SELECT uid2 FROM friend WHERE uid1='".$uid."'";
Run Code Online (Sandbox Code Playgroud)
权限可能存在问题.您可能需要授予user_status权限.
请参阅此处 - http://developers.facebook.com/docs/authentication/permissions
| 归档时间: |
|
| 查看次数: |
1935 次 |
| 最近记录: |